Grant Accountant Overview The Grant Accountant is responsible for managing the full life cycle of assigned grants, from award through close-out, ensuring accurate billing, reporting, and compliance with funder requirements. This role includes preparing and submitting timely invoices and financial reports, performing budget-to-actual analyses, monitoring expenditures for allowability, and supporting both internal reporting and external audits. The ideal candidate is detail-oriented and analytical, with a strong grasp of financial compliance, grant guidelines, and forecasting. They will work closely with program managers and the finance team to ensure data accuracy, support strategic decision-making, and implement process improvements for increased efficiency in financial reporting. Responsibilities · Manage assigned grants from award to close-out. ·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ual invoices and financial reports for grant funders. · Monitor grant expenditures and compare against budgets for allowability and compliance. · Support internal reporting processes including budget vs. actual analysis. · Review GL activity and work with the finance team to execute reclasses when necessary. · Conduct variance analysis and assist with budget forecasts. · Assist with grant budget development and revisions. · Interpret funder guidelines to ensure financial compliance. · Provide audit support through documentation and analysis. · Support internal teams in understanding grant budgets and financial status. · Work closely with program managers to provide tracking, financial analysis, and review of grant claims. Qualifications · Bachelor’s degree in accounting, Finance, or a related field. · At least 3 or more years’ experience in grant or project accounting. · Strong Excel skills (pivot tables, VLOOKUPs, forecasting). · Experience using Oracle or a similar ERP system. · Knowledge of Uniform Guidance (2 CFR 200) and cost allowability rules · Experience working with federal and state grants. · Experience in nonprofit or public-sector environments.
